Most software written for Windows 98 would work on Windows XP. Not all, but most of them would still work. Try installing your Epson scanner software on your Windows XP then...
Go to the Epson scanner icon, the icon you would usually click on to start the software, what you need to try doing is to right-click on the icon to bring up a sub menu, click on 'Properties' to open the Properties box. Look for the 'Compatibility' tab (usully the 3rd tab) and click on it. then under the 'Compatibility mode', but a tick in the box where it says 'Run this program in compatibility mode for:' and then below that pull down the menu, select Window 98 / Windows Me'
This should be the first option to try before you think about installing Windows 98 as most of the times, this compatibility mode would sometimes fix the problems.
Unless you already tried it and it fails, I would suggest you try it first just in case.
